Geneenlisted in the U.S. Army in April 1966 where he served in Vietnam for 18months. On July 19, 1968 he married Loraine Minor. While in the Ar-my, Gene wasawarded The National Defense
ServiceMedal, Vietnam Service Medal with 3 bronze service stars, and a Republic ofVietnam Campaign Medal. He was
honorablydischarged in April 1969.
Gene workedas a Union Steward for 25 years. He resided in Indianapolis, IN all of hisadult life and enjoyed watching sports, reading the newspaper, taking pictures,and shooting pool with his friends.
Gene made aconfession of faith at an early age. He later joined New Light Christian Churchunder Pastor Michael Scaife, where he served as a Deacon. Gene later joined hiswife under Pastor
Dr. T.Garrett Benjamin and Pastor Dr. David A. Hampton at Light of The WorldChristian Church where he was a member until he de-parted this life.
